Unmasking the Significance of Insider Transactions
Insider transactions, although significant, should be considered within the larger context of market analysis and trends.
In the context of legal matters, the term "insider" refers to any officer, director, or beneficial owner holding more than ten percent of a company's equity securities, as outlined by Section 12 of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934. This includes executives in the c-suite and significant hedge funds. Such insiders are obligated to report their transactions through a Form 4 filing, which must be completed within two business days of the transaction.
Pointing towards optimism, a company insider's new purchase signals their positive anticipation for the stock to rise.
Despite insider sells not always signaling a bearish sentiment, they can be driven by various factors.
Essential Transaction Codes Unveiled
When dissecting transactions, the focal point for investors is often those occurring in the open market, meticulously detailed in Table I of the Form 4 filing. A P in Box 3 denotes a purchase, while S signifies a sale. Transaction code C indicates the conversion of an option, and transaction code A denotes a grant, award, or other acquisition of securities from the company.
